| Index: content/browser/web_contents/web_contents_impl.cc
|
| diff --git a/content/browser/web_contents/web_contents_impl.cc b/content/browser/web_contents/web_contents_impl.cc
|
| index 435f5b1a6cb226efc428256c1ebd5346898372d9..5b733a7e2e102f5cf21b0ed379a5c4a5e889c111 100644
|
| --- a/content/browser/web_contents/web_contents_impl.cc
|
| +++ b/content/browser/web_contents/web_contents_impl.cc
|
| @@ -1321,6 +1321,15 @@ void WebContentsImpl::ShowContextMenu(
|
| render_view_host_delegate_view_->ShowContextMenu(params);
|
| }
|
|
|
| +void WebContentsImpl::RequestMediaAccessPermission(
|
| + const content::MediaStreamRequest* request,
|
| + const content::MediaResponseCallback& callback) {
|
| + if (delegate_)
|
| + delegate_->RequestMediaAccessPermission(this, request, callback);
|
| + else
|
| + callback.Run(content::MediaStreamDevices());
|
| +}
|
| +
|
| void WebContentsImpl::UpdatePreferredSize(const gfx::Size& pref_size) {
|
| preferred_size_ = pref_size;
|
| if (delegate_)
|
|
|